Output 18aef326a4162054e5598f307389064927ec74d7606b09d39d4bf3c3c928d798:1

value
909280
script pubkey
OP_0 OP_PUSHBYTES_20 bf16c081c17ede2ff920799366058e10ae2db081
address
ltc1qhutvpqwp0m0zl7fq0xfkvpvwzzhzmvyphm6q9q
transaction
18aef326a4162054e5598f307389064927ec74d7606b09d39d4bf3c3c928d798
spent
true